The Rise of Paint Your Life Scam

Over the past few years, the popularity of personalized paintings has skyrocketed. Companies like Paint Your Life have taken advantage of this trend by offering to turn customers’ photos into custom-made paintings. However, with the rise of this trend comes the rise of scams.

How the Scam Works

The Paint Your Life scam typically involves a fake website or social media account that claims to offer custom-made paintings at a discounted price. Once the victim sends a photo and payment, the scammer disappears, leaving the victim with nothing but lost money.

Red Flags to Look Out For

To avoid falling victim to the Paint Your Life scam, it’s important to look out for certain red flags. These include:

  • Unsolicited emails or social media messages
  • Offers that seem too good to be true
  • Poor grammar and spelling on the website or social media account
  • No customer reviews or testimonials
  • No contact information or a fake address

How to Protect Yourself

To protect yourself from the Paint Your Life scam, follow these tips:

  1. Research the company before making a purchase
  2. Only use trusted websites or social media accounts
  3. Check for customer reviews and testimonials
  4. Avoid sending payment through unsecured channels
  5. Use a credit card, which offers more protection than a debit card or wire transfer

What to Do if You Fall Victim

If you do fall victim to the Paint Your Life scam, don’t panic. Here’s what you can do:

  1. Contact your bank or credit card company to dispute the charge
  2. Report the scam to the Federal Trade Commission
  3. File a complaint with your local law enforcement agency
  4. Spread the word to prevent others from falling victim to the scam
